Population-based data on influenza hospitalizations are unavailable in the United Kingdom, but they represent an essential component of health economic analyses that could support the use of vaccines and antiinfluenza drugs in healthy children. We collected data on hospitalizations for influenza infections among young children in Leicester, UK.
